• 程序员面试题精选100题(16)-O(logn)求Fibonacci数列[算法]

    时间:2023-12-06 15:42:24

    作者:何海涛出处:http://zhedahht.blog.163.com/题目:定义Fibonacci数列如下:/  0                      n=0f(n)=      1                      n=1        \  f(n-1)+f(n-2)   ...

  • 算法与数据结构(九) 查找表的顺序查找、折半查找、插值查找以及Fibonacci查找

    时间:2023-12-04 17:31:33

    今天这篇博客就聊聊几种常见的查找算法,当然本篇博客只是涉及了部分查找算法,接下来的几篇博客中都将会介绍关于查找的相关内容。本篇博客主要介绍查找表的顺序查找、折半查找、插值查找以及Fibonacci查找。本篇博客会给出相应查找算法的示意图以及相关代码,并且给出相应的测试用例。当然本篇博客依然会使用面向...

  • Fibonacci(数论 输出前四位Fibonacci)

    时间:2023-11-26 21:06:15

    FibonacciTime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 4221    Accepted Submission(s): 1954...

  • UVa #11582 Colossal Fibonacci Numbers!

    时间:2023-11-25 20:12:52

    巨大的斐波那契数The i'th Fibonacci number f (i) is recursively defined in the following way:f (0) = 0 and f (1) = 1f (i+2) = f (i+1) + f (i)  for every i ≥ 0Y...

  • UVa 11582 (快速幂取模) Colossal Fibonacci Numbers!

    时间:2023-11-15 17:53:14

    题意:斐波那契数列f(0) = 0, f(1) = 1, f(n+2) = f(n+1) + f(n) (n ≥ 0)输入a、b、n,求f(ab)%n分析:构造一个新数列F(i) = f(i) % n,则所求为F(ab)如果新数列中相邻两项重复出现的话,则根据递推关系这个数列是循环的。相邻两项所有可...

  • 算法系列:Fibonacci

    时间:2023-10-05 09:46:20

    https://www.zhihu.com/question/28062458http://blog.csdn.net/hikean/article/details/9749391对于Fibonacci数列,1,1,2,3,5,8,13,21...   F(0) = 1, F(1) = 1, F(i...

  • Fibonacci again and again

    时间:2023-09-12 12:05:16

    Fibonacci again and againhttp://acm.hdu.edu.cn/showproblem.php?pid=1848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Oth...

  • 入门训练 Fibonacci数列

    时间:2023-08-04 22:33:18

      入门训练 Fibonacci数列  时间限制:1.0s   内存限制:256.0MB问题描述Fibonacci数列的递推公式为:Fn=Fn-1+Fn-2,其中F1=F2=1。当n比较大时,Fn也非常大,现在我们想知道,Fn除以10007的余数是多少。输入格式输入包含一个整数n。输出格式输出一行,...

  • 蓝桥杯 入门训练 Fibonacci数列(水题,斐波那契数列)

    时间:2023-08-04 22:29:36

    入门训练 Fibonacci数列时间限制:1.0s   内存限制:256.0MB问题描述Fibonacci数列的递推公式为:Fn=Fn-1+Fn-2,其中F1=F2=1。当n比较大时,Fn也非常大,现在我们想知道,Fn除以10007的余数是多少。输入格式输入包含一个整数n。输出格式输出一行,包含一个...

  • 蓝桥网试题 java 入门训练 Fibonacci数列

    时间:2023-08-04 22:27:31

    ----------------------------------------------------------------------------------------------------------------------------------------------自己的理解:因为...

  • [18/12/3]蓝桥杯 练习系统 入门级别 Fibonacci数列求模问题 题解思路

    时间:2023-08-04 22:14:41

    前言略.看到这个题目本来应该很高兴的,因为什么,因为太TM的基础了啊!可是当你用常规方法尝试提交OJ时你会发现..hhh...运行超时..(开心地摇起了呆毛 //Fibonacci数列递归一般问题常规方法(当目标序列号<32时适用 评判标准:运行时间<1.00s) #include &l...

  • 【蓝桥杯】入门训练 Fibonacci数列

    时间:2023-08-04 22:09:38

      入门训练 Fibonacci数列  时间限制:1.0s   内存限制:256.0MB问题描述Fibonacci数列的递推公式为:Fn=Fn-1+Fn-2,其中F1=F2=1。当n比较大时,Fn也非常大,现在我们想知道,Fn除以10007的余数是多少。输入格式输入包含一个整数n。输出格式输出一行,...

  • POJ3070 Fibonacci(矩阵快速幂加速递推)【模板题】

    时间:2023-07-14 11:20:51

    题目链接:传送门题目大意:求斐波那契数列第n项F(n)。(F(0) = 0, F(1) = 1, 0 ≤ n ≤ 109)思路:用矩阵乘法加速递推。算法竞赛进阶指南的模板:#include <iostream>#include <cstring>using namespace...

  • 斐波那契数列Fibonacci问题—动态规划

    时间:2023-05-17 21:23:26

    斐波那契数列定义Fibonacci array:1,1,2,3,5,8,13,21,34,...在数学上,斐波那契数列是以递归的方法来定义:F(0) = 0F(1) = 1F(n) = F(n-1) + F(n-2)用文字描述,就是斐波那契数列由0和1开始,之后的斐波那契系数就是由之前的两数之和想加...

  • 使用并行的方法计算斐波那契数列 (Fibonacci)

    时间:2023-05-17 21:23:20

    更新:我的同事Terry告诉我有一种矩阵运算的方式计算斐波那契数列,更适于并行。他还提供了利用TBB的parallel_reduce模板计算斐波那契数列的代码(在TBB示例代码的基础上修改得来,比原始代码更加简洁易懂)。实验结果表明,这种方法在计算的斐波那契数列足够长时,可以提高性能。矩阵方式计算斐...

  • 练习六:斐波那契数列(fibonacci)

    时间:2023-05-17 21:23:44

    题目:斐波那契数列。程序分析:斐波那契数列(Fibonacci sequence),又称黄金分割数列,指的是这样一个数列:0、1、1、2、3、5、8、13、21、34、……。在数学上,斐波那契数列是以递归的方法来定义:F0 = 0 (n=0)F1 = 1 (n=1)Fn = F[n-1]+ F...

  • 9 斐波那契数列Fibonacci

    时间:2023-05-17 21:23:38

    题目1:写一个函数,输入n,求Fibonacci数列的第n项。该数列定义如下:n=0时,f(n)=0;n=1时,f(n)=1;n>1时,f(n)=f(n-1)+f(n-2)1、 效率差的递归算法:时间复杂度以n的指数的方式递增。因为求f(10)=f(9)+f(8);f(9)=f(8)+f(7)...

  • Go斐波拉契数列(Fibonacci)(多种写法)

    时间:2023-05-17 21:23:32

    1 前言斐波拉契数列有递归写法和尾递归和迭代写法。2 代码//recursionfunc fib(n int) int{if n < 2{return n}else{return fib(n-1) + fib(n-2)}}func fibcore(n int) (int,int){if n &...

  • Java实现斐波那契数列Fibonacci

    时间:2023-05-17 21:23:26

    import java.util.Scanner;public class Fibonacci { public static void main(String[] args) { // TODO Auto-generated method stub Scanner...

  • HDU - 1588 Gauss Fibonacci (矩阵高速幂+二分求等比数列和)

    时间:2023-04-18 11:56:56

    DescriptionWithout expecting, Angel replied quickly.She says: "I'v heard that you'r a very clever boy. So if you wanna me be your GF, you should solve...